| Aspect | Africa Program Assistant | Africa Program Coordinator |
|---|---|---|
| Responsibilities | Supports program activities, assists with logistics, and provides administrative support | Manages program implementation, oversees activities, and coordinates teams |
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's degree, relevant experience, strong organizational skills | Bachelor's or master's degree, experience in program management, leadership skills |
| Work Environment | Office-based, field support, collaborative teams | Office-based with field visits, leadership in project execution |
| Industry Usage | Common entry-level or support role in NGOs and development agencies | Mid-level role with increased responsibility in program management |
The Africa Program Assistant typically provides support and administrative assistance within programs, while the Africa Program Coordinator takes on a leadership role in managing and overseeing program activities. Both roles require relevant experience and work within similar environments, but the coordinator position involves greater responsibility and oversight.

Position: Assistant Coach, Baseball (Full-Time, 12-Month) (2 Positions Available)
Effective Date: On or about July 1, 2026 (1-Year Appointment, Renewable)
Salary Range: The Coach (12-Month) classification salary is $93,960 to $153,252 per year (paid as 12 monthly payments). Salary offered is commensurate with qualifications and experience.
Application Deadline: Review of applications to begin June 15, 2026. Position open until filled (or recruitment canceled).
Long Beach State Athletics
Required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ree
Prior athletic participation in Baseball
Demonstrated commitment to working successfully with a diverse student population, including Black/African American, Latine/x, Native American/Indigenous, low-income, first-generation, and minoritized students.
Preferred Qualifications:
Knowledge of and adherence to NCAA rules and regulations
Experience in Baseball as a player or coach at the college level
Demonstrated ability to assist with coaching and recruiting quality student-athletes
Computer experience
Public relations skills
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, and excellent organizational skills
Duties:
Assist with the development and supervision of the student-athletes in the Baseball program
Assist the program in accordance with National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) Division I, Big West Conference, and University rules, regulations and policies
Recruit student-athletes in accordance with NCAA regulations and academic standards, as well as University requirements
Assist with scheduling nationally competitive teams in conjunction with the Head Coach
Assist in the planning and coordinating of in-season practices, including team and individual workouts
Assist in the planning and coordinating of out-of-season practices, including individual skill instruction and team workouts, focusing on the development of athletic skills to compete at the Division I level
Assist in monitoring the academics of each of the Baseball student-athletes
Effectively communicate with Athletics Academic Advisor to ensure any academic concerns are being addressed
Assist with the planning and implementing of game plans, including development of scouting reports of opponents
Assist with budgetary responsibilities including recruitment, team travel, and equipment
Coordinate strength and conditioning program with assigned Strength and Conditioning Coach
Complete all necessary compliance forms as required and/or requested by the Athletics Compliance Office in a timely manner
Support all marketing activities of the Department of Athletics for the Baseball program
Participate in fund raising activities for the Baseball program and/or Department of Athletics
Cultivate and maintain effective relationships with students, parents, faculty, staff, media, and friends of the university.
Perform computer related tasks
Perform other duties as assigned by Head Coach and Sport Supervisor
